Desperate for headache tablets, man holds up pharmacy in Sweden
0 Comments | AFP, December, 2004
STOCKHOLM (AFP) — A man brandishing a gun-like object held up a drugstore in the small southwestern Swedish town of Bollebygd and made off with his booty: a package of headache tablets, Swedish media reported.
The man walked into the pharmacy, pulled out an object that resembled a gun and said "This is a robbery", pharmacy employees told news agency TT.
The bandit then said he needed some Treo comp, a brand of headache and pain relief pills, and was given a small package before making his getaway.
